Sparkling Tart Cherry Juice Mocktail Recipe

Sparkling Tart Cherry Juice Mocktail Recipe


5 Stars 4 Stars 3 Stars 2 Stars 1 Star

4 from 26 reviews

  • Author: Alice
  • Total Time: 5 minutes
  • Yield: 2 servings
  • Diet: Vegan

Description

This sparkling tart cherry juice mocktail is a refreshing and fruity non-alcoholic drink made from tart cherry juice, fresh lime and orange juices, a hint of sweetness, and sparkling water. Perfectly chilled and garnished with fresh cherries, lime, and mint, it is an ideal beverage for summer parties, brunches, or relaxing evenings that offers a healthy and flavorful alternative to alcoholic cocktails.


Ingredients

Mocktail Base

  • 1/2 cup tart cherry juice
  • 1 tablespoon fresh lime juice
  • 2 tablespoons orange juice
  • 1 teaspoon honey or maple syrup (optional)

Sparkling Component

  • 1/2 cup sparkling water or club soda, chilled

Garnish

  • Ice cubes
  • Fresh cherries, for garnish
  • Lime wedges or slices, for garnish
  • Fresh mint (optional)


Instructions

  1. Prepare Glass: Fill a tall glass with ice cubes to chill the drink and keep it refreshing.
  2. Mix Juices: In the glass, add the tart cherry juice, fresh lime juice, orange juice, and honey or maple syrup if using. Stir well until all ingredients are fully combined to ensure even flavor distribution.
  3. Add Sparkling Water: Slowly pour the chilled sparkling water or club soda over the juice mixture. Pouring slowly helps maintain the carbonation, keeping the drink fizzy.
  4. Gently Stir: Give the drink a gentle stir to blend the sparkling water with the juice mixture without losing too much of the carbonation.
  5. Garnish and Serve: Garnish the mocktail with fresh cherries, a lime wedge or slice, and fresh mint if desired. Serve immediately while cold and sparkling for best taste and presentation.

Notes

  • Use unsweetened tart cherry juice if you prefer a less sweet mocktail.
  • For a party pitcher, mix the tart cherry juice, lime juice, orange juice, and sweetener ahead of time and add sparkling water just before serving to maintain fizz.
  • Substitute ice cubes with frozen cherries for extra flavor without diluting the drink.
  • Adding a splash of ginger beer introduces a spicy, refreshing twist.
  • Increase the honey or add simple syrup for a sweeter mocktail.
